Former President Donald Trump’s campaign rally in Uniondale is set to take place on Wednesday.
The rally will be held at Nassau Coliseum.
Nassau County Police Commissioner Patrick Ryder tells News 12 residents can expect to see an increased police presence in and around the Coliseum.
"We will make sure that it is one of the safest venues in the country, guaranteed. And then outside we'll have a large gathering, I'm sure, and again, we will make sure that everyone is protected when you come to that date,” said Ryder.
The rally is set to begin at 7 p.m. and doors open at 3 p.m.
